What Hampshire County homes commonly need

As part of Massachusetts's New England region, Hampshire County sees freeze & ice dams, heating strain, and older-home repair. With about 162,502 residents across 3 recorded places, the everyday repair list stays busy year-round.

Hampshire County has grown about 10.8% since 2020 — roughly 15,886 more residents — so a large share of the housing stock is recent. Newer homes generate punch-list, finish, and fixture work rather than system replacement, and fast-growing counties tend to have trade capacity already committed to new construction, which is why a small repair here can take longer to schedule than its size suggests.

Hampshire County accounts for 2.3% of Massachusetts's residents, 10th of the state's 14 counties by population. Outside the top few counties the everyday trades are still well covered, but the specialised end — sewer, structural, whole-system electrical — thins out, and that is the work most likely to involve a drive and a scheduling wait.

The largest county bordering Hampshire County is Worcester County, with about 866,866 residents — a bigger market than this one, and the direction most of the specialist crews come from when the local list runs short.

Licensed trades work across county lines: Hampshire County borders Worcester County, Hampden County, Berkshire County, and Franklin County, and most crews quoting here quote there too. That is why Massachusetts pricing reads more honestly at the regional level than city by city.

Scope moves that number more than the ZIP code does. For the same water heater replacement in Hampshire County, our model puts a repair the existing at $850–$1,300 and a major / whole-system at $2,950–$4,400 — roughly 3.4× the spread. That is why a phone quote given before anyone has seen the job is worth very little, and why the estimator asks what the work actually involves.

Timing carries a real premium too. A central AC repair booked as planned work prices at $425–$650 in Hampshire County; the same job as same-day emergency service prices at $500–$725, about 14% higher. If the job can wait a week, waiting a week is the cheapest change you can make to it.

Every figure on this page is multiplied by a Massachusetts cost factor of 1.15 — labor and materials here run about 15% above the national baseline in our 2026 model. That adjustment is applied before you see a number, which is why these ranges differ from the national averages quoted on most cost-guide sites.
